Agro-ecosystem analysis is a tool that can help farmers to develop skills and knowledge about ecosystems, and to make better decisions. Working in groups, farmers can observe field situations and make notes about the ecosystem, for example, about the crops, insects, diseases, weeds, water, and weather. This information can then be used to help farmers to make better decisions about how to manage their farms.<\/p>\n
